Bunny napkin fold

Easter napkin folding is a sweet extra touch that’s guaranteed to make guests smile. With just a napkin, ribbon, and a little folding magic, you'll have a charming table setting that'll have you hopping with joy.

You'll need:

  • 1 napkin (the contrasting scalloped edge from our Amor napkins gives that “ear” effect)
  • 1 egg (real, plastic, or even a treat-filled one)
  • Ribbon or twine for tying

Step-by-step instructions

1. Lay it flat
Start by folding your napkin in half. Smooth it out on your surface.

2. Roll it up
From the long edge, begin tightly rolling the napkin all the way to the top.

3. Nest the egg
Place your egg right in the centre of the rolled napkin. If using a real egg, add it right at the end to avoid food waste. Simply leave a gap where the egg will lay.

4. Wrap it snug
Bring both ends of the napkin up and around the egg as if you’re cradling it.

5. Tie the bow
Hold the ends together above the egg and secure them with ribbon or twine. A soft pink bow adds a lovely, luxe touch.

6. Shape the ears
Finally, fan out the loose ends of the napkin to form cute bunny ears. You can give them a slight bend for extra character.

Heart napkin fold

Whether it’s Valentine’s Day, an anniversary, or you just want to share the love, our love heart napkin fold is a thoughtful addition to your table. All you need is a napkin and a few clever folds.

Step-by-step instructions:

1. Fold into a triangle
Lay your napkin flat in a diamond shape, then fold it in half to make a triangle.

2. Fold into the centre
Take both side points and fold them into the centre. Then fold the sides in again, shaping a narrow diamond.

3. Flip and roll
Flip the napkin over and roll it upwards from the pointed end about three times.

4. Shape your heart
Flip it back around and gently pull the top corners down and out to form a heart.

Christmas tree napkin fold

Bring a touch of festive flair to your table with this simple but impressive Christmas tree napkin fold. It’s elegant, easy, and adds instant seasonal charm.

You'll need:

  • 1 square napkin (green or metallic beautifully)
  • Optional: A small star decoration for the top

Step-by-step instructions

1. Square things up
Fold your napkin into a square (half, then half again), then turn it so it sits like a diamond with the open corners pointing down.

2. Layer the branches
With the open corner facing you, begin folding each of the top layers up toward the opposite corner, leaving about an inch of space between each fold to create a tiered effect.

3. Shape the silhouette
Flip it over carefully. Fold both sides in toward the middle to shape your tree. Flip it back.

4. Build your branches
Now, starting at the top, fold each flap up. Tuck each one into the fold above it to form neat “branches.”

5. Add the finishing touch
Tuck the final flap underneath, and if you’re feeling extra festive, pop a little star on top.

Bow napkin fold

Chic, charming, and beautifully simple, this bow napkin fold adds a playful yet polished touch to any place setting. Ideal for birthdays, baby showers, or just to add a little extra to your everyday dining.

You'll need: 

  • A napkin
  • A napkin ring

Step-by-step instructions

1. Start with a triangle
Fold your napkin in half diagonally to create a triangle.

2. Fold the tip down
Take the top point of the triangle and fold it down about three-quarters of the way.

3. Begin rolling up
Fold the bottom edge up and over the folded triangle, roughly a third of the way.

4. Keep folding
Continue folding upward until you have a long, layered strip.

5. Shape the ends
Fold the right end down at an angle. Then fold the left end across horizontally, creating soft bow-like tails.

6. Add the napkin ring
Pinch the centre of the napkin and slide your napkin ring over both ends, placing it neatly in the middle.

7. Fluff and finesse
Pull the ends down gently while adjusting the sides of the bow. Flip over for a final tweak and perfect your shape.
